The Modern Scholar's Guide to Book Collecting by Anne Bills is an informative resource designed for both novice and experienced collectors. It offers practical advice on how to start a collection, evaluate the value of books, identify rare editions, and maintain a collection effectively. The guide combines historical insights with contemporary tips, making it a comprehensive manual for anyone interested in the art and science of book collecting.
